rust-lang/rust#92413 (comment) failed due to a request timeout, plausibly because of a parallel request (e.g., metrics) which locked out the database for long enough to cause a failure. This changes our retry logic to hopefully always retry timed out requests.
(It does not take the step we took with docker builds of unilaterally retrying all requests, but that may be a better path rather than trying to guess... for now this seems a more limited answer).
